Understanding the Dynamics of a Sexless Marriage
Recognizing the signs of a sexless marriage is the first step toward addressing the issue. Many couples experience a decline in intimacy, but pinpointing the root causes can be challenging. A sexless marriage is often defined by a significant decrease in sexual activity, sometimes less than once a month. However, it’s important to understand that this issue is not just about physical intimacy but also emotional disconnection.
Identifying the Signs
Subtle signs of a sexless marriage can include a lack of physical affection, such as hugging or holding hands, and a general disinterest in intimacy. Couples may also notice a decline in emotional connection, leading to feelings of isolation. Communication becomes strained, and both partners may feel unheard or unappreciated.
Common Causes and Misconceptions
Mismatched libidos and external stressors like work or family pressures are common causes. Many couples assume that a lack of interest in sex means one partner has “checked out,” but this isn’t always the case. Effective communication is key to understanding each other’s needs and desires. Ignoring these issues can lead to resentment and further emotional disconnection.
Addressing these dynamics early on can prevent the relationship from deteriorating further. By fostering open dialogue and understanding, couples can work together to reignite their connection and build a stronger, more intimate relationship.

Enhancing Communication to Foster Intimacy
Open and honest communication is the cornerstone of any healthy relationship, especially when it comes to rebuilding sexual intimacy. When both partners feel heard and understood, it creates a safe environment for emotional and physical connection to flourish.
Effective Dialogue Strategies
Starting conversations about intimacy can be challenging, but approaching them with empathy and without blame is crucial. Use “I” statements to express your feelings, such as, “I feel closer to you when we share intimate moments,” instead of making your partner feel defensive. This approach fosters a supportive dialogue where both of you can openly discuss your needs and desires.
Addressing Unspoken Issues
Unspoken concerns often lead to emotional and physical disconnection. Identify the root causes of the lack of intimacy by asking yourself questions like, “What has changed in our relationship?” or “What fears might be holding us back?” Addressing these issues together can help you both understand each other’s perspectives and work toward a solution.
By embracing honest discussions, you can bridge communication gaps and strengthen your relationship. Remember, open dialogue is not just about solving problems—it’s about nurturing a deeper emotional and physical connection with your partner.

Addressing Physical and Health-Related Aspects
Physical health plays a significant role in sexual desire and marital satisfaction. Ignoring health issues can lead to a decline in intimacy, making it essential to address these factors.
Managing Stress and Its Effects on Libido
Stress is a common cause of reduced libido. Elevated cortisol levels disrupt sex hormones, dampening desire. Chronic stress can lead to emotional detachment, affecting both partners.
When to Seek Medical Advice
Certain health issues may require professional intervention. Conditions like erectile dysfunction or post-childbirth recovery can impact intimacy. Medication side effects and chronic illnesses are other factors to consider.
- Physical health issues and stress directly affect libido and performance.
- Stress reduces sex hormones, lowering desire.
- Seek medical advice for conditions like erectile dysfunction.
- Medications and chronic illnesses can contribute to intimacy issues.
- Addressing both mental and physical health is crucial for intimacy.
Recognizing these aspects can help couples take proactive steps toward restoring their connection and overall marital satisfaction.
